- Bluetooth | Definition, Uses, History, Facts | Britannica
Bluetooth, technology standard used to enable short-range wireless communication between electronic devices Bluetooth was developed in the late 1990s and soon achieved massive popularity in consumer devices

- What Is Bluetooth® Technology? - Intel
Bluetooth technology is primarily used to wirelessly connect peripherals to mobile phones, desktops, and laptops Some of the most common Bluetooth accessories include mice, keyboards, speakers, and headphones Many gaming controllers use Bluetooth technology for wireless connectivity as well
- Understanding Bluetooth Technology - CISA
What is Bluetooth? Bluetooth technology allows devices to communicate with each other without cables or wires Bluetooth relies on short-range radio frequency, and any device that incorporates the technology can communicate as long as it is within the required distance
